  2. Bethany College is a private Christian college in Lindsborg, Kansas. It was founded in 1881, making it one of the oldest colleges in Kansas. History. Bethany College at the turn of the twentieth century. Bethany College, established by Swedish Lutheran immigrants in 1881, is a college of the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America (ELCA).

  3. Bethany College (KS) is a private institution that was founded in 1881.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 744 (fall 2022), its setting is rural, and the campus size is 80 acres.

  7. Bethany College (Kansas) is a small private college located on a rural campus in Lindsborg, Kansas.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 737, and admissions are selective, with an acceptance rate of 72%. The college offers 41 bachelor's degrees, has an average graduation rate of 30%, and a student-faculty ratio of 14:1.
